Types of Small Beverage Vending Machines

When considering a small beverage vending machine, it’s essential to understand the various types available on the market. Each type has its unique features and ideal applications.

1. Mini Vending Machines

Mini vending machines are compact and designed to fit in limited spaces. They typically offer a selection of snacks and beverages. Ideal for small offices or homes, they provide convenience with a limited capacity of around 30-60 items.

2. Cold Drink Vending Machines

These machines specialize in cold beverages, such as sodas and juices. With a larger capacity—often around 180 cans—these machines are perfect for high-traffic areas like gyms, schools, or public spaces. Their design often includes features such as adjustable shelves for easy loading.

3. Combo Vending Machines

Combo machines offer both snacks and drinks in one unit, making them versatile for various settings. With around 23 selections, they are popular in breakrooms or lounges, providing an all-in-one solution for employees and visitors.

4. Custom Vending Machines

For businesses looking to stand out, custom vending machines can be tailored to specific product offerings. This type allows for unique branding and product selection, ideal for events or parties where a personalized touch is desired.

Key Features to Look For

When selecting a small beverage vending machine, several key features can enhance your experience and usability.

1. Capacity

The capacity of the machine determines how many items it can hold. Consider the space and traffic where the machine will be placed. For example, a cold drink vending machine from discountvending.com with a 180-can capacity is suitable for busy environments.

2. Product Variety

Look for machines that offer a diverse range of products. This can include different sizes of cans and bottles, as well as healthy options. Vendingmachinehub.com highlights the importance of selecting machines that cater to various preferences.

3. User Interface

A user-friendly interface makes it easier for customers to operate the machine. Features like touch screens or clear labeling of products can significantly enhance the user experience.

4. Maintenance and Warranty

Consider machines that come with a warranty and are easy to maintain. Vendingworld.com emphasizes the need for reliable parts and service to ensure the machine operates smoothly.

Technical Features Comparison

Model Capacity Product Types Dimensions Warranty
IndusBay Mini Vending Machine 30-60 Snacks, drinks 24″ x 18″ x 48″ 90 days
DVS Duravend 36B 180 Cold beverages 36″ x 30″ x 72″ 1 year
Combo Vending Machine 23 Snacks, drinks 30″ x 25″ x 70″ 6 months
Custom Vending Machine Varies Custom products Customizable Varies

FAQ

What is a small beverage vending machine?
A small beverage vending machine is a compact unit designed to dispense a variety of drinks, including sodas and juices. They are typically used in homes, offices, and public spaces for convenience.

How much do small beverage vending machines cost?
Prices for small beverage vending machines can vary significantly depending on the model and features, typically ranging from $500 to over $3,000.

Where can I place a small beverage vending machine?
These machines can be placed in various locations, including offices, gyms, schools, and even at home, making them versatile for different environments.

What types of drinks can I stock in a small vending machine?
You can stock a variety of drinks, including sodas, juices, flavored waters, and energy drinks, depending on the machine’s capacity and product selection.

How do I maintain a small beverage vending machine?
Regular maintenance includes cleaning the machine, checking for inventory levels, and ensuring all components are functioning correctly. It’s also essential to follow any manufacturer-specific guidelines.
